Architecture Quality Assessment
Static-analysis pipeline that scores a codebase's architecture (0-100) and reports violations with file:line detail and fix recommendations. Analysis-only — never edits code. Supports Python and JS/TS projects (Next.js, React, Vue, Express, NestJS, FastAPI, Django, Flask).
Workflow
-
Run the assessment:
bash ~/.claude/skills/architecture-quality-assess/skill.sh [PROJECT_PATH] [OPTIONS]
The project root must contain a manifest (package.json, requirements.txt, or pyproject.toml) or project detection fails.
-
CLI options (verified against scripts/assess.py --help — trust this table over older docs):
| Option | Meaning | Default |
|---|
project_path | Directory to analyze | . |
--format {markdown,json,tasks,all} | Report format(s) | markdown |
--output, -o | Output file path | <project>/architecture-assessment.{md,json} |
--severity {critical,high,medium,low} | Minimum severity reported | low |
--verbose, -v | Detailed progress | off |
--no-cache | Force full re-parse | caching on |
--list-analyzers | List analyzers and exit | — |
Caution: README.md mentions --incremental, --cache, --generate-tasks, and --config; those flags do NOT exist in assess.py. Use --format tasks for the task list.
-
Read the report (architecture-assessment.md in the project root): overall score, then violations by severity (critical → low), each with file, line, and recommendation. Exit code is 1 when critical violations exist — usable directly as a CI gate (--format json --severity critical).

What it analyzes
Seven analyzers: project/framework detection, layer separation (Clean Architecture), SOLID (all 5 principles), design patterns and anti-patterns, coupling metrics + circular dependencies, code organization, and memory-bank drift.
